"source": [
"# TODO"
"def desv_std (data):\n",
" n=len(data)\n",
" mean = sum(data)/n\n",
" variance = sum((x - mean) ** 2 for x in data) / (n - 1)\n",
" std_dev = variance ** 0.5\n",
" return std_dev\n",
"\n",
"data = [4,2,5,8,6]\n",
"\n",
"print(desv_std(data))"
